The office of Graduate Student and Postdoctoral Development (GSPD) is the hub of professional development for all graduate students and postdocs at UMBC. We hope to provide a community of learning and support from when you arrive on campus to the proud day you depart for the next stage of your career.
In your time here, we hope you come to rely on our office for seminars on preparing for a career as a faculty member, building skills in teaching and public speaking, enhancing your writing and writing productivity, and learning to network to build a community of peers and mentors effectively. You can learn about the latest offerings and workshops from our website and myUMBC page. We frequently partner with the Graduate Student Association and other organizations on campus.

Within our office are PROMISE, a community and set of programming mainly designed for minoritized scholars in the sciences. PROMISE programming was NSF funded from 2003-2018 and included a PROMISE network across UMBC, UMB, and College Park. This programming, community, and network continue to thrive on our campuses today.

Expanding on the PROMISE programming is the new AGEP PROMISE Academy, a fellowship for underrepresented postdocs within USM who seek a tenure track position in USM.
